Research Associate, Protein Engineering

Job Summary: 
The Protein Engineering Team is looking for a RA/SRA to join our cross-functional team and contribute to the discovery and development of novel gene editing systems. This role affords the opportunity to hone molecular biology techniques and help develop new assays and methods in a fast-paced environment all while making a broad impact on Arbor’s productivity and portfolio. The ideal candidate will have hands-on experience in the wet laboratory, an appetite for learning a wide variety of topics, excellent organizational skills, attention to detail, and the ability and self-motivation to work independently.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Technical Responsibilities
  • Perform molecular biology techniques including bacterial transformation and culture, plaque assay 
  • Perform PCR, DNA mutagenesis, DNA library cloning using standard molecular biology tools
  • Help develop and perform assays to characterize and screen novel gene editing systems
  • Document, compile, and analyze experimental data
  • Communicate results at team meetings, contribute to project and experiment planning
  • Develop and maintain protocols, operational processes, and best practices

Preferred Qualifications:
  • Bachelor’s degree in molecular biology, biochemistry, or a related field with at least 1-3 years of relevant experience
  • Highly motivated, driven, and curious with a strong desire to learn new technologies
  • A strong work ethic and positive attitude
  • Experience with DNA library build or CRISPR-Cas gene editing systems is a plus
